20 | %description | |
21 | DBMAIL is a collection of programs that enables email to be | |
22 | stored in and retrieved from a database. | |
23 | ||
24 | Why is it usefull? | |
25 | ================== | |
26 | Well, for me it's usefull because a number of reasons. | |
27 | - it enables me to create mailboxes without the need of systemusers. | |
28 | - mail is more effeciently stored and therefore it can be inserted | |
29 | an retrieved much faster dan any regular system (DBmail is currently | |
30 | able to retrieve aprox. 250 mail messages per second) | |
31 | - it's more expandable. A database is much easier to access than | |
32 | a flat file or a Maildir. We don't need to parse first. | |
33 | - In my case, i can easily link a mailbox to a certain client | |
34 | which enables me to let the client maintaining his/her own mailboxes | |
35 | without me needing to technically support it. | |
36 | - It's scalable. You can run the dbmail programs on different servers | |
37 | talking to the same database(cluster). | |
38 | - It is more secure. There's no need to maintain system users or write | |
39 | to the filesystem. All this is done through the database. | |
